dc.description.abstract | The interaction between Terfenol-D (Tb(x)Dy(1-x)Fey (0.27 <= x <= 0.30, y <= 2)) melts and quartz crucibles has been studied. A rare earth silicide was formed next to a rare earth oxide on SiO2 substrate and a surface layer of rare earth oxide appeared on top of the silicide layer. The reaction was controlled by diffusion with an activation energy E-a = 1.59 eV. The effect of Si contamination on the magneto-elastic property was evaluated. Maximum mangnetostriction of Terfenol-D decreased by 300 ppm while Si addition increased up to 1.0 at.%. (c) 2005 Elsevier B.V. All rights reserved. | - |
